The Trinidad and Tobago Police Service has confirmed that Kaia Sealy, the girlfriend of Joshua Samaroo, is to be charged in connection with his fatal shooting.
In a statement, the TTPS said a comprehensive investigation was conducted into the incident of January 20th, 2026, after which a detailed case file was submitted to the Office of the Director of Public Prosecutions (DPP). Following review and consultation, the DPP advised that criminal charges be laid.
“Acting on the advice of the DPP, investigators conducted further enquiries and obtained warrants for the arrest of Kaia Sealy of Bamboo Settlement No. 1, Valsayn for the following offences: Three counts of Shooting with Intent to Cause Grievous Bodily Harm at the police, contrary to Section 12 of the Offences Against the Person Act, Chapter 11:08, in relation to the incident which occurred on January 20th, 2026, at the corner of College Road and Bassie Street Extension, St. Augustine. Additionally, a warrant has been issued for the offence of: Manslaughter, Contrary to Common Law, in that on January 20th, 2026, at the corner of College Road and Bassie Street Extension, St. Augustine, Kaia Sealy unlawfully killed Joshua Samaroo, in addition to other related charges.”
